Output 5895dafdf67c883244048560dbccb36cfe188bf26789431f9d4c4e6a3e7e3174:0

value
25143939
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ec6d42fda1371a2c9e0a6c56e291dac25de4050 OP_EQUALVERIFY OP_CHECKSIG
address
1E1w97SJ2T8Cvok4jB6JUYFXQjyWqeYjej
transaction
5895dafdf67c883244048560dbccb36cfe188bf26789431f9d4c4e6a3e7e3174
spent
true